系下专题

C++程序设计:画图(在直角坐标系下对矩形进行着色,求着色面积)

【问题描述】   在一个定义了直角坐标系的纸上,画一个(x1,y1)到(x2,y2)的矩形指将横坐标范围从x1到x2,纵坐标范围从y1到y2之间的区域涂上颜色。    下图给出了一个画了两个矩形的例子。第一个矩形是(1,1) 到(4, 4),用绿色和紫色表示。第二个矩形是(2, 3)到(6, 5),用蓝色和紫色表示。图中,一共有15个单位的面积被涂上颜色,其中紫色部分被涂了两次,但在计算面积时只

点在不同平面直角坐标系下的坐标转换

点在不同平面直角坐标系下的坐标转换 1.拟解决问题 如下图所示, 已知O’1在蓝色坐标系XOY的坐标为(x01,y01 ); 已知O’2在蓝色坐标系XOY的坐标为(x02,y02 ); 已知O’1X’1与OX夹角为θ1; 已知O’2X’2与OX夹角为θ2; 将P1点在黑色区域坐标系X1’O1’Y1’下的坐标值(x1’,y1’)转化成蓝色坐标系XOY的坐标值(x1,y1 );将P2点在黑色区域坐标